• DocumentCode
    2175264
  • Title

    A High-Performance Network Interface Architecture for NoCs Using Reorder Buffer Sharing

  • Author

    Ebrahimi, Masoumeh ; Daneshtalab, Masoud ; Liljeberg, Pasi ; Plosila, Juha ; Tenhunen, Hannu

  • Author_Institution
    Dept. of Inf. Technol., Univ. of Turku, Turku, Finland
  • fYear
    2010
  • fDate
    17-19 Feb. 2010
  • Firstpage
    546
  • Lastpage
    550
  • Abstract
    Increasing memory parallelism in MPSoCs to provide higher memory bandwidth is achieved by accessing multiple memories simultaneously. Inasmuch as the response transactions of concurrent memory accesses must be in-order, a reordering mechanism is required. To our knowledge the resource utilization of conventional reordering mechanisms is low. In this paper, we present a novel network interface architecture for on-chip networks to increase the resource utilization and to improve overall performance. Also, based on the proposed architecture, a hybrid network interface is presented to integrate both memory and processor in a tile. The proposed architecture exploits AXI transaction based protocol to be compatible with existing IP cores. Experimental results with synthetic test cases demonstrate that the proposed architecture outperforms the conventional architecture in terms of latency. Also, the cost of the presented architecture is evaluated with UMC 0.09 ¿ m technology.
  • Keywords
    buffer storage; network routing; network-on-chip; AXI transaction based protocol; IP core; NoC; hybrid network interface; memory parallelism; network interface architecture; reorder buffer sharing; resource utilization; size 0.09 mum; Bandwidth; Costs; Delay; Network interfaces; Network-on-a-chip; Protocols; Resource management; Routing; System-on-a-chip; Tiles; AXI protocol; Buffer Management; Network Interface; Network on Chip;
  • fLanguage
    English
  • Publisher
    ieee
  • Conference_Titel
    Parallel, Distributed and Network-Based Processing (PDP), 2010 18th Euromicro International Conference on
  • Conference_Location
    Pisa
  • ISSN
    1066-6192
  • Print_ISBN
    978-1-4244-5672-7
  • Electronic_ISBN
    1066-6192
  • Type

    conf

  • DOI
    10.1109/PDP.2010.77
  • Filename
    5452473